I have a 2002 disco 2 se7, low mileage barely driven great shape < i live in MI have never driven this vehicle in the winter< lately when i leave it sitting on a hill or tipped to drivers side the AIR BAGS go down, left side only < do i need to replace them ?

Wile a leak seems obvious, where might be a question. You can mix up soapy water in a squirt bottle and mist suspect areas, they'll bubble just like the leak in an old inner tube. That might eliminate certain fittings, etc, or the bags.
